Blue Magic Couldn T Get To Sleep Last Night
Blue Magic is an R&B group that originated from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. The group was formed in 1972 and was composed of four members: Theodore Mills, Vernon Sawyer, Wendell Sawyer, and Keith Beaton. The group's music was known for their smooth harmonies, soulful vocals, and R&B funk sound.
